Lukas Hinterseer is an Austrian association football player born on March 28, 1991, in Kitzbühel. He plays as a forward and holds Austrian citizenship. His father is Guido Hinterseer, and he is related to Hansi Hinterseer. He speaks German.
Hinterseer began his work period in 2009. He has played for FC Ingolstadt 04, FC Wacker Innsbruck, FC Lustenau 07, WSG Swarovski Tirol, and the Austria men's national football team. Encyclopedic overview
Lukas Hinterseer (born 28 March 1991) is an Austrian professional footballer who plays as a forward for WSG Tirol.
Born in Kitzbühel, Tyrol, Hinterseer began his career at local club FC Kitzbühel before signing for FC Wacker Innsbruck in 2008. After initially struggling to make the first team, he experienced a breakthrough in the 2013–14 season. His form earned him a move to German football, where he played for FC Ingolstadt, VfL Bochum, Hamburger SV, Hannover 96 and Hansa Rostock.
